As part of a diverse and hardworking team, you will advocate system engineering and integration practices across disciplines and teams in areas of electrical analysis, design, maintenance and integrated testing. This position will directly impact the history of space exploration and will require your dedicated commitment and detailed attention towards safe and repeatable spaceflight. Y ou will be responsible for seamless and interrupted operations across a high-volume of Blue Origin facilities including our launch pad by planning, implementing and maintaining the infrastructure and equipment of buildings and facilities by performing preventive maintenance, troubleshooting, root cause analysis, energy use, repairs and modifications on a variety of electrical systems such as switchgears, switchboards, panelboards, transformers, generators and Uninterruptable Power Systems. You will be involved in electrical systems engineering and maintenance, including requirements development and decomposition, technical trade study support, risk management, verification planning and testing. These responsibilities will require a wide application of advanced systems engineering principles, theories and concepts plus a working knowledge of other related disciplines. In this role, you will assist the Blue Origin Facilities team with coordination and planning, interfacing with program management and customers, and providing guidance to less experienced engineers on the team.
